Transaction 964305e3091447c512483b06cc85c67fab89a76bc8f59ffb602747f1030a9313
2 Input
2 Outputs
- 964305e3091447c512483b06cc85c67fab89a76bc8f59ffb602747f1030a9313:0
- 964305e3091447c512483b06cc85c67fab89a76bc8f59ffb602747f1030a9313:1
value 139500000
address 1NgV4hRch3CgoHmtnbzTwHwjGhJTR3U31R
value 157468
address 1Feo889gYw1Geed1bPEVmtGRiYf9hp5wSV